COSATU (Congress of South African Trade Unions) charges its members a monthly membership fee that typically ranges from 1% to 1.5% of a member's monthly salary, depending on the specific trade union within COSATU. The exact fee can vary by union and may also be influenced by additional factors such as the member's occupation and industry. For the most accurate and current information, it's best to consult COSATU's official resources or the specific union a member belongs to.
